Bit of a knock in gearbox area

Featured Replies

When the clutch is let out in first I hear a slight knock, this only happens once as if it's taking up the slack in the drive train. When I change to second I get the knock noise again as I let the clutch out. If I let off the throttle and reapply I get the knock so it sounds like something is loose.

I originally thought it was the DMF but this has been replaced along with the clutch so I'm now thinking drive shafts, but there is no noticeable knocking on full lock.

Any ideas?
